Baotou Shansheng captive power station (包头市山晟自备电厂) is a 100-megawatt (MW) coal-fired power station in Inner Mongolia Autonomous Region, China.[1][2]

Project Details

  • Sponsor: Baotou City Shansheng New Energy Co., Ltd.
  • Parent: Inner Mongolia Yidong Investment Group (87.88%), Inner Mongolia Hongyuan Coal Group Co (3.44%), Inner Mongolia Hengdong Energy Group Co (3.44%), Other (5.25%)
  • Location: Tumud Right Banner, Baotou, Inner Mongolia, China
  • Coordinates: 40.58437536, 110.6231523 (exact)
  • Status: Operating
  • Gross capacity: 100 MW (Units 1-2: 50 MW)
  • Type:
  • In service: 2009
  • Coal type: Waste coal
